Uma folha de estilo XSL é um arquivo que permite que você personalize e lay out de documentos XML em uma página da Web ou em um aplicativo de desktop. O documento XSL tem vários recursos avançados e uma dessas características é chamar um método Java, que é uma função localizada em uma classe Java. Primeiro, você deve apontar para a classe Java que contém o método que você deseja chamar , então você pode chamar o método dentro do corpo da folha de estilo XSL . Instruções
1
botão direito do mouse o documento XSL que você deseja editar e selecione " Abrir com". Escolha o seu editor XSL você deseja usar para adicionar o método Java.
2
Adicione o pacote directiva inclusão Java na seção de definição principal da folha XSL . A definição do arquivo é a primeira definição de marca . Adicione o seguinte código para o tag:
xmlns : str = " Xalan ://org.apache.commons.lang.StringUtils "
Neste exemplo os " StringUtils " Java classe está incluído . Altere a classe com o nome da classe que contém o método que você deseja usar.
3
Adicione a chamada para o método no corpo da folha XSL . Por exemplo, se você quiser alterar o nome do cliente para todos os caracteres maiúsculos a seguinte tag XSL usa o " maiúscula" método Java :
< xsl: valor de select = " str : maiúsculas (string ( CustomerName ) ) ">